Add certbot, more vhosts
This commit is contained in:
parent
da7c256b08
commit
be20575334
|
@ -6,12 +6,36 @@
|
|||
- ./vars/main.yml
|
||||
|
||||
vars:
|
||||
certbot_create_if_missing: yes
|
||||
certbot_admin_email: opdavies+https@gmail.com
|
||||
certbot_certs:
|
||||
- email: '{{ certbot_admin_email }}'
|
||||
domains:
|
||||
- oliverdavi.es
|
||||
- www.oliverdavi.es
|
||||
- domains:
|
||||
- oliverdavies.uk
|
||||
- www.oliverdavies.uk
|
||||
nginx_vhosts:
|
||||
- listen: 80
|
||||
server_name: 'oliverdavi.es www.oliverdavi.es'
|
||||
return: 301 https://{{ server_name }}$request_uri
|
||||
filename: oliverdavi.es.80.conf
|
||||
|
||||
- listen: 80
|
||||
server_name: 'oliverdavies.uk www.oliverdavies.uk'
|
||||
return: 301 https://{{ server_name }}$request_uri
|
||||
filename: oliverdavies.uk.80.conf
|
||||
|
||||
- listen: 443 ssl
|
||||
server_name: 'oliverdavies.uk www.oliverdavies.uk'
|
||||
extra_parameters: |
|
||||
ssl_certificate /etc/letsencrypt/live/oliverdavies.uk/fullchain.pem;
|
||||
ssl_certificate_key /etc/letsencrypt/live/oliverdavies.uk/privkey.pem;
|
||||
ssl_trusted_certificate /etc/letsencrypt/live/oliverdavies.uk/fullchain.pem;
|
||||
return: 301 https://{{ server_name }}$request_uri
|
||||
filename: oliverdavies.uk.443.conf
|
||||
|
||||
- listen: 443 ssl
|
||||
server_name: oliverdavi.es
|
||||
extra_parameters: |
|
||||
|
@ -180,4 +204,7 @@
|
|||
filename: www.oliverdavi.es.443.conf
|
||||
|
||||
roles:
|
||||
- name: geerlingguy.certbot
|
||||
tags: ['certbot']
|
||||
- name: geerlingguy.nginx
|
||||
tags: ['nginx']
|
||||
|
|
|
@ -1,3 +1,6 @@
|
|||
---
|
||||
- src: geerlingguy.certbot
|
||||
version: 3.0.0
|
||||
|
||||
- src: geerlingguy.nginx
|
||||
version: 2.5.0
|
||||
|
|
Loading…
Reference in a new issue